※ Optical Fiber Collimator Descriptions
AIMLASER provides the aspheric fiber collimator designed to collimate or focus light emitted from FC/APC, FC/PC, or SMA905 fiber connectors. The aspheric lens introduces chromatic dispersion, and its effective focal length (EFL) varies with wavelength. At the design wavelength, it provides diffraction-limited performance with excellent spherical aberration correction, making it suitable for simple fiber coupling applications.
The compact design uses a molded aspheric lens with double-sided anti-reflection (AR) coatings on both surfaces to minimize reflection losses. For the FC/APC version, the angled connector ensures the output beam enters the collimator perpendicular to the focal plane.
The aspheric fiber collimator is available for design wavelengths from 400 nm to 1600 nm. Versions with FC/PC, FC/APC, and SMA905 connectors are offered. ※ Optical Fiber Collimator Characteristics
| ITEM | SPECIFICATIONS |
| Model Number | Optical Fiber Lens Collimator |
| Wavelength | 400nm~1600nm |
| Beam Size | Ø1mm@10mm |
| Focus | Adjustable |
| Transmittance | ≥95% |
| Return Efficiency | ≥80%(MMF), ≥30%(SMF), |
| Fiber Type | 3um~800um |
| Lens | AR Coated Aspheric Lens |
| Dimensions | 12x25.6mm |
| Connector | FC/PC, FC/APC, SMA905 |
| Material | 304 Stainless Steel |
